Data (Use and Access) Bill [HL]Contribution
The data Bill was not hijacked by creatives to get in the way of the Government’s growth plans. We have made grown-up interventions to rescue an AI policy written by a serial tech investor with a conflict of interest so deep that at some point it will feature in an ITV drama—a tech investor who has access to the Cabinet and who has failed to make the case for why other people’s property or, indeed, property paid for by the UK taxpayer should be given away to some of the most capitalised businesses in history—but it is based on this policy that the Government have deliberately rejected the Lords’ will to uphold property rights, and it is based on this policy that they have chosen to stand in the way of allowing creative workers and companies to protect their assets and future income for themselves.
